Entropy generation of Al2O3/water nanofluid in corrugated channels

Abstract

The flow of nanofluids in a corrugated channel has been shown to have a significant impact on heat transfer performance, and has therefore become an important area of research. The ob- jective of this paper is to understand the thermal behavior of Al2O3/water nanofluid in a sinu-soidal and square channel and to identify ways to optimize heat transfer performance in such configurations. For this purpose, a numerical simulation was conducted using ANSYS-Fluent software 16.0 on entropy generation and thermo-hydraulic performance of a wavy channel with the two corrugation profiles (sinusoidal and square). The analyses were carried out under laminar forced convection flow conditions with constant heat flux boundary conditions on the walls. The influence of various parameters, such as particle concentration (0–5%), particle di-ameter (10nm , 40nm and 60nm), and Reynolds number (200 < Re < 800) on the heat transfer, thermal, and frictional entropy generation, and Bejan number was analyzed. Moreover, the distribution of streamlines and static temperature contours has been presented and discussed, and a correlation equation for the average Nusselt number based on the numerical results is presented. One of the most significant results obtained is that the inclusion of nanoparticles (5% volume fraction) in the base fluid yielded remarkable results, including up to 41.92% and 7.03% increase in average Nusselt number for sinusoidal and square channels, respectively. The sinusoidal channel exhibited the highest thermo-hydraulic performance at Re= 800 and φ= 5%, approximately THP= 1.6. In addition, the increase of nanoparticle concentration from 0% to 5% at Re= 800 and dnp= 10nm, diminishes the total entropy generation by 28.39 % and 22.12 % for sinusoidal and square channels, respectively, but when the nanoparticle diameter decreases from 60nm to 10nm at ϕ= 5% and Re= 800, the total entropy generation in the sinusoidal channel decreases by 34.85%, whereas in the square channel, it decreases by 20.05%. Therefore, rather than using a square channel, it is preferable and beneficial to use small values of nanoparticle diameter and large values for each of ϕ and Re in the sinusoidal wavy channel. Overall, the study of nanofluid flow in a wavy channel can provide valuable insights into the behavior of nanofluids and their potential applications in a variety of fields, including manufacturing, energy produc-tion, mining, agriculture, and environmental engineering.
